Bradenton lawn fungus concentrates in two environments: the shaded, established neighborhoods where mature tree canopy creates a permanent humidity chamber at the turf level, and the newer East Bradenton and Lakewood Ranch communities where irrigation-heavy HOA lawns stay wet long enough for fungal spores to germinate and spread.

Both produce the same result — yellow-then-brown patches, thinning turf, or a slow decline that does not respond to fertilizer. But the specific pathogen and the conditions driving it are often different, and that difference determines whether treatment works or wastes money.

Bayshore Gardens — Shade, Thatch, and Chronic Take-All

Bayshore Gardens has some of the most mature tree canopy in Bradenton. The live oaks, laurel oaks, and mature landscaping that make the neighborhood attractive also create persistent shade and humidity at ground level. St. Augustine growing under that canopy has reduced vigor, and reduced vigor means reduced resistance to fungal infection.

Take-all root rot is the chronic disease in Bayshore Gardens. The combination of shade, humidity, organic-rich soil from decades of leaf litter, and the older root systems on mature St. Augustine creates a near-permanent take-all environment. The Gaeumannomyces pathogen lives in the soil year-round and becomes active whenever conditions favor it — which under Bayshore’s canopy is most of the year.

The take-all misdiagnosis cycle is common here. The lawn yellows slowly. The homeowner applies fertilizer. The grass greens up for two weeks, then crashes harder. Another fertilizer application, another green-then-crash cycle. What is happening: quick-release nitrogen feeds the fungus at the root level more than it helps the grass above. By the time someone identifies the actual problem, the root system has been compromised for months.

Take-all treatment is a program: soil acidification with elemental sulfur, fungicide rotation over two to three months, strict slow-release nitrogen only, higher mowing height, and morning-only irrigation. Recovery takes eight to twelve weeks once the program starts.

West Bradenton and Palma Sola — Coastal Humidity

The neighborhoods along Palma Sola Bay and west of US-41 deal with a humidity profile similar to Venice Island. Onshore breezes carry moisture that keeps turf damp longer after rain, extending the leaf-wetness window that drives gray leaf spot and brown patch.

Gray leaf spot appears in these neighborhoods during July through September when summer humidity peaks. The small gray-black lesions on individual blades thin the turf overall. Morning irrigation that runs into the afternoon extends the infection window because the blades never fully dry between the morning watering and the afternoon humidity spike.

Brown patch is the winter concern along the bayfront. Circular patches with a darker outer ring appear from October through March. The cooler temperatures slow turf recovery, so brown patch in waterfront West Bradenton neighborhoods tends to persist longer than the same disease in sunnier, better-drained areas inland.

East Bradenton and LWR Border — Irrigation and Clay

The newer communities east of I-75 and along the Lakewood Ranch border have the same irrigation-driven fungus problem as Palmer Ranch in Sarasota. HOA irrigation schedules run aggressively, reclaimed water carries nitrogen and phosphorus that feed both turf and pathogens, and compacted clay-fill construction holds moisture in the root zone.

Brown patch, gray leaf spot, and take-all all hit these communities, often on the same property in different seasons. The underlying driver is always the same: too much water on turf growing in soil that does not drain.

Old Manatee — The Urban Canopy Overlap

The historic neighborhoods around Old Manatee, including Fogartyville and the streets near Riverwalk, have dense canopy and older St. Augustine similar to Bayshore Gardens. Take-all and gray leaf spot are the dominant diseases. The treatment approach mirrors what we use in Bayshore: pathogen confirmation, soil amendment, fungicide rotation, and cultural practice adjustments.

We confirm the pathogen before treating. Brown patch, gray leaf spot, take-all, and Pythium all produce yellowing and thinning that looks similar at first glance. The chemistry is different for each, and the cultural corrections that prevent recurrence depend entirely on getting the initial diagnosis right.

Is it fungus or chinch bugs?

Fungus damage tends to be circular or ring-shaped, often with a darker outer edge and lighter or sunken center. Damage patterns are more uniform and spread outward predictably. Chinch bug damage is concentrated in hot sunny areas (south side, near driveway) and the dead turf feels crunchy. Pull a few blades — fungal lesions (spots, rings, gray patches on the leaf) are visible with the naked eye. Chinch bug-damaged blades are just dry and uniform.

What fungal diseases hit Bradenton lawns?

Main ones: brown patch / large patch (cool season — fall/winter/spring), gray leaf spot (hot humid summer), take-all root rot (chronic, year-round, often in shaded or poorly drained spots), and Pythium (hot humid summer, fast-moving, looks like irregular dark wet patches). Each requires different fungicide chemistry.

Why won't fertilizer fix my yellowing lawn?

If the yellowing is from take-all root rot, fertilizer actually makes it worse — quick-release nitrogen feeds the fungus more than it helps the grass. Take-all is the single most commonly misdiagnosed Bradenton lawn issue; homeowners fertilize repeatedly while the disease spreads. Proper ID first, then the right treatment (soil acidification, fungicide rotation, and careful fertilization with slow-release only).

Will my lawn recover after fungus treatment?

Usually yes — but timing varies by pathogen. Gray leaf spot treated early recovers in 3–4 weeks. Brown patch recovers in 4–6 weeks. Take-all root rot is a multi-month recovery because you're rebuilding the root system. Pythium recovers in 2–3 weeks once stopped. Severe damage in any pathogen may need plugging.

Can I just reseed or re-sod the dead patches?

Not before the fungus is controlled, no. Fresh sod dropped into an active disease area will be infected within weeks and the money is wasted. Treat first, confirm the disease is stopped for 3–4 weeks, then sod or plug. We coordinate the full sequence if you want.
